Step 3.7 Flash
Step 3.7 Flash is StepFun's latest high-efficiency multimodal Mixture-of-Experts model. It pairs a 196B-parameter language backbone with a vision encoder for native image and video understanding, activating roughly 11B parameters...
Technical Specifications
| Specification | Claude Opus 4.1 | Step 3.7 Flash |
|---|---|---|
| Provider | Anthropic | StepFun |
| Context Window | 200,000 tokens | 256,000 tokens |
| Agent Suitability | N/A | N/A |
| Time to First Token (TTFT) | N/A | N/A |
| Deployment Model | managed api | managed api |
| Production Stability | stable | stable |
| API Available | Yes | Yes |
| Released Date | 2025-08-05 | 2026-05-28 |
